By Type:
Hydroponic fertilizers are available in various forms, including liquid fertilizers, powder fertilizers, and granular fertilizers.
Liquid fertilizers are the most commonly used in hydroponic systems due to their ease of use and ability to be absorbed quickly by plants. These are often preferred for their high solubility in water, making it easier to mix and apply.
Powder fertilizers are another form used in hydroponic systems. They are typically mixed with water to form a solution and are favored for their cost-effectiveness and longer shelf life.
Granular fertilizers are also available but less commonly used in hydroponics. They require specific formulations to ensure that nutrients are released slowly and evenly over time.
The choice of fertilizer type impacts how easily nutrients are delivered to plants, and each type has advantages depending on the specific hydroponic system being used.

By End-User:
The primary end-users of hydroponic fertilizers include commercial growers, home gardeners, and research institutions.
Commercial growers are the largest consumers, as they use hydroponic systems for large-scale production of crops, particularly in urban settings and controlled environments like greenhouses.
Home gardeners have increasingly adopted hydroponics for personal use, especially those interested in growing their own fresh produce in limited space.
Research institutions use hydroponic fertilizers for agricultural studies, often to test new fertilizer compositions or explore the viability of hydroponics for various crops.
